About Marlesford
Marlesford is a small village located in Suffolk, England, within the IP13 postcode area. The village is situated near the River Deben and is surrounded by the scenic countryside typical of this part of East Anglia. It features a few residential homes and local amenities, making it a quiet place for those seeking a slower pace of life.
One notable landmark is the Marlesford Mill, which has historical significance and adds to the village's character. The village is also conveniently located near larger towns, providing easy access to additional services and attractions. The surrounding area offers various walking paths, allowing visitors to explore the natural beauty of Suffolk.

Household Income in Marlesford ONS 2023
The average total household income in Marlesford is approximately £60,865 a year before tax, 10%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£43,984.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Marlesford ONS 2025
There are approximately 1,297 active businesses based in Marlesford, around 58 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 13 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Marlesford
Of the 9,682 households in and around Marlesford, 74% are owned, 13% are socially rented and 14%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Marlesford.
